The requirement in Florida.

State law now expects verified, current campus mapping. Here is the shape of it.

K-12 districts

Under Florida Statute 1013.13, every public school district is required to keep walk-through-verified critical incident maps, revised by October 1 each year. Accurate field data is what keeps those maps honest as buildings change.

Florida College System

All 28 Florida College System institutions carry the same requirement across every campus. We already produce this field capture for campuses in Florida, and we are ready for the rest.

A map is only useful if it matches the building.

Campuses change. A wall moves, a wing is added, a door is renumbered, a portable arrives. Old architectural drawings drift out of date, and a map that no longer matches the building is worse than no map at all in a moment that counts.

That is why the verification is done on foot. We scan the campus for accurate geometry, then walk every space to confirm it against reality. The result is a current record, refreshed on the schedule the requirement expects.
